My dad and I picked up one of these a while back. Overall, it is a great rifle, but it does have a few quirks that came out in use:
1. There is no way to increase the magazine capacity to more than 3 rounds. I called Savage, and they have no other magazines for it. The one it comes with looks like it is just a .308 magazine with a block in the back of it. Maybe Dark Eagle (?) or Sharpshooters' Supply might have a modified magazine or conversion for it... We haven't looked into it any further.
2. There are no graduation lines on the rear sight and it has no "ears" or other protection to prevent it from getting moved during accidental rough handling (which a scout rifle should be prepared for, in my opinion...)
Otherwise, it has been a great rifle! With open sights, using Tula steel-cased ammo, it has printed 4" groups at 200 yards, so nothing to sneeze at!
